About Four Winds Island Part Two The Lockwood Jewels (1961) — Family Adventure on a Sicilian Treasure Hunt

Embark on a sun-drenched treasure hunt in *Four Winds Island Part Two: The Lockwood Jewels* (1961), a vintage family adventure film directed by David Villiers. Set against the rugged beauty of a small Sicilian island, this serial follows a spirited schoolgirl as she uncovers the mystery of lost heirloom jewels hidden decades ago. With a blend of suspense and heartwarming determination, the story weaves themes of discovery, family legacy, and the thrill of solving a decades-old puzzle.
